The Decadent Garlic Chicken Recipe

Garlic chicken: Master tender, pan-seared chicken breasts smothered in a decadent, creamy roasted garlic sauce in under 45 minutes. A restaurant-quality meal at home.

Ingredients
  

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.3 lbs/600g total)
  • 1/2 tsp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p freshly cracked black pepper
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tbsp butter, divided
  • 1 whole garlic bulb (about 8-9 garlic cloves)
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 3/4 cup heavy cream

Method
 

  1. Fillet each chicken breast into two thinner cutlets.
  2. Season chicken with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Coat evenly with flour.
  3. Heat olive oil and 1 Tbsp butter in a skillet over medium heat. Sear chicken until golden brown and cooked through (approx. 4 mins per side). Remove chicken and keep warm.
  4. While chicken cooks, peel garlic cloves and smash them with the side of a knife.
  5. Add remaining 1 Tbsp butter to the skillet over medium-low heat. Sauté garlic for 3 minutes until fragrant, stirring often to prevent burning.
  6. Pour in chicken broth and heavy cream. Stir to scrape up browned bits. Simmer for 8-10 minutes until sauce reduces and thickens.
  7. Return chicken to the skillet. Spoon sauce over chicken and heat through. Serve immediately.

Notes

- Roast the garlic gently until fragrant to avoid bitterness.
- Reserve about 1/4 cup of the sauce before adding chicken back to thin if needed.
- For extra flavor, garnish with fresh chopped parsley or chives.
